Congressional Action on Defense Appropriations
Legislative Efforts to Fund the Department of Defense in FY2026
In June 2025, the House and Senate Committees on Appropriations and Armed Services held hearings on the Department of Defense (DOD) Appropriations Act, 2026. Between June 10 and 18, 2025, Secretary of Defense Pete Hegseth and Ch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ff General Dan Caine attended each of the hearings and provided witness statements on defense appropriations requirements. During the hearings, committee members questioned Hegseth and Caine about budget details, modernization delays, the controversial use of troops for domestic law enforcement, the Golden Dome missile defense, and the Trump Administration’s focus on border security.
